Calculating points in Points Rummy
The first player to announce the valid declaration is the winner of the game. The winner in Points Rummy gets 0 points. If a challenger or more drops the game in their first move, they are charged with 20 points each. However, the game continues until there is a single winner.

How do you win in rummy?
When a player gets rid of all of their cards, they win the game. If all of their remaining cards are matched, the player may lay them down without discarding on their last turn. This ends the game and there is no further play.Are 10s 10 points in rummy?

A set is a group of three or four cards of the same rank but different suits. Both printed jokers as well as wild jokers can be used in a set. The dealer shuffles the deck and passes out cards clockwise for each player. If two people play, then each player receives 10 cards. For three or four players, each receives 7 cards. For five or six players, each receives 6 cards.Do you have to go out to win in rummy?
A player wins the hand by being the first to play all the cards in their hand by either melding, laying off or discarding. Once a player has gone out, the hand is ended. No other players may meld, lay off or discard their cards even if they have valid combinations already in their hand.What is each round in rummy?
